About Michael Ebsen

Michael Ebsen is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Surgery, Molecular Biology,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ems and Immunology, having authored 42 papers that have together received 698 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(14 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(9 papers),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(6 papers), Medical Imaging and Pathology Studies (5 papers), Congenital Diaphragmatic Hernia Studies (4 papers), Genetic and Kidney Cyst Diseases (3 papers), Tracheal and airway disorders (3 papers) and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(200 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(58 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(238 citations), Oncology (194 citations) and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(20 citations). Michael Ebsen has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Japan and United States. Frequent co-authors include Christoph Röcken, Dirk Theegarten, Susanne Sebens, Ilka Vogel, Thomas Becker, Evelin Grage‐Griebenow, H. Schäfer, Ole Helm, Dieter Kabelitz and Uwe Krüger. Their work appears in journals such as Neonatology, Intensive Care Medicine, PLoS ONE, Infection and Immunity and Respiration.
